Project Summary

This is Lunix Ewe, an embedded Java™ virtual machine derived from Ewesoft Linux® Ewe.

This fork has been created to bypass the time until the next generation of embedded VMs, namely Eve, is ready to use, and is not intended to infringe Ewesoft or their products in any way whatsoever. It’s a fun project, done to improve portability of CacheWolf and fix some bugs. We would be glad if our changes could be merged back into the main project.

Ewe is a programming system that allows you to write applications, using Java, which run exactly the same on desktop systems, on mobile systems, and even in a Web browser as an Applet.

Ewe is the fastest starting, most memory efficient mobile or desktop VM.
